Educational Grants for Dads

New York State Tuition Assistance Program (TAP)

Grant up to $5,665/year — never repaid.

Apply: https://www.hesc.ny.gov

FAFSA: https://studentaid.gov

“An annual TAP award can be up to $5,665… it does not have to be paid back.”

Aid for Part Time Study (APTS)

Up to $2,000/year for part time students.

Note: Program sunsets after 2024–25.

Info: https://www.hesc.ny.gov

Tax Credits That Put Money Back in Your Pocket

Earned Income Tax Credit (EITC)

Up to $8,046 for families with 3+ children.

How to claim: File IRS Form 1040

Free tax help: 800 906 9887 (VITA)

Child Tax Credit (CTC)

Up to $2,000 per child (up to $1,700 refundable).

Info: https://www.irs.gov

Childcare Support for Working or Studying Dads

New York Child Care Assistance Program (CCAP)

Helps pay for childcare while you work, job search, or attend school.

Outside NYC: https://ocfs.ny.gov/programs/childcare/

NYC: https://mycity.nyc.gov

“Your family may qualify… if income falls below 85% of the State Median Income.”
